On behalf of the Apache Cassandra >>> Project Management Committee (PMC) I would like to welcome and congratulate >>> our next PMC Chair Dinesh Joshi (djoshi). >>> >>> Dinesh has been a member of the PMC for a few years now and many of you >>> likely know him from his thoughtful, measured presence on many of our >>> collective discussions as we've grown and evolved over the past few years. >>> >>> I appreciate the project trusting me as liaison with the board over the >>> past year and look forward to supporting Dinesh in the role in the future. >>> >>> Repeating Mick (repeating Paulo's) words from last year: The chair is an >>> administrative position that interfaces with the Apache Software Foundation >>> Board, by submitting regular reports about project status and health. Read >>> more about the PMC chair role on Apache projects: >>> - https://www.apache.org/foundation/how-it-works.html#pmc >>> - https://www.apache.org/foundation/how-it-works.html#pmc-chair >>> - https://www.apache.org/foundation/faq.html#why-are-PMC-chairs-officers >>> >>> The PMC as a whole is the entity that oversees and leads the project and >>> any PMC member can be approached as a representative of the committee.
